Things to do in Bothell?
Bothell, WA is a lively suburb located outside of Seattle on the northern end of Lake Washington in Snohomish County. It is home to many tech companies and offers plenty of shopping, dining and entertainment options along its bustling waterfront area known as the Northshore Landing.
